The American College of Surgeons (ACS) Resident Award for Exemplary Teaching, sponsored by the ACS Division of Education, is given each year in recognition of excellence in teaching by a resident and to emphasize teaching as an important area in residents’ daily lives.
In 2024, the 22nd annual ACS Resident Award for Exemplary Teaching was presented to Rick D. Vavolizza, MD.
Candidates who show outstanding contributions to educational activities, educational publications, teaching award recipients and provide course instruction are strongly encouraged for consideration.

Eligible nominees are residents in good standing in an accredited surgery residency program, including specialty programs. Graduating chief residents are eligible. Residents must have received prior recognition of their outstanding efforts in teaching by having received internal teaching awards at their current institution. Teaching efforts directed toward medical students, fellow residents, or other allied health personnel can be recognized. These are the areas upon which the candidates will be evaluated:
Documentation supporting teaching excellence may be furnished in the form of evaluations completed by students. Efforts made by the nominee to improve the educational environment of the institution by serving on education committees, organizing courses, or participating in educational programs will also be considered in the selection process. Nominations will be accepted from program directors and department chairs and will be reviewed by an independent review panel of the ACS Committee on Resident Education. Each surgery residency program, including specialty programs, may nominate one resident.
